Non-A, non-B hepatitis, recently renamed as hepatitis C virus (HCV), accounts for over 90% of hepatitis cases worldwide associated with blood transfusions. Application of a recombinant-based enzyme immunoassay for the detection of antibodies to HCV to a sample of 500 male Saudi blood donors and 260 healthy Saudi pregnant women indicated that HVC is endemic in the Saudi population. Anti-HCV was detected in 28 (5.6%) of the blood donors and 12 (4.6%) of the pregnant women, for an overall frequency of 5.3% in healthy Saudi adults who had never received blood transfusions. This rate is at least 5 times higher than that reported for the US and Western Europe. Also assessed was the HCV rate in subsamples of Saudis considered at risk of this infection. Here, anti-HCV was detected in 22 (78.6%) hemophiliacs, 26 (33.3%) patients with
thalassemia
and sickle cell disease, 17 (26.1%) hemodialysis patients with renal failure, and 35 (15.9%) individuals with a sexually transmitted disease. The prevalence of anti-HBc ranged from 28% in blood donors to 46% in hemophiliacs. The significantly higher prevalence of HCV in patients with sexually transmitted diseases than in blood donors suggests that this disease is transmitted through heterosexual contact as well as blood transfusions. Given the high baseline level of HCV infection in the Saudi population and the possibility of serious sequelae (e.g.,
chronic active hepatitis
, cirrhosis, and hepatocellular carcinoma), routine anti-HCV screening of blood donations is urged.

Seventeen of 73 (23.3%) multiply transfused patients with
thalassaemia
major (age range, 1-39 years) tested positive for antibody to hepatitis C virus (anti-HCV). Eleven of the 24 patients regularly transfused in countries outside Britain were anti-HCV seropositive; only six of the 49 regularly transfused in Britain were seropositive. The incidence of anti-HBs and anti-HBc was similar to that of anti-HCV in both the British and foreign patients. The anti-HCV seropositive patients showed significantly higher plasma aspartate aminotransferase activities (AST), mean (SD) 10.2 (70.3) U/l, and serum ferritin concentrations, 4067 (2708) micrograms/l, than the anti-HCV seronegative patients (AST, 33.9 (15.6) U/l; serum ferritin 2051 (2092) U/l), respectively. Among the 36 patients who had earlier undergone liver biopsy 10 of 21 with histological features of
chronic active hepatitis
or cirrhosis, or both, were seropositive for anti-HCV whereas only one of 15 without histological evidence of chronic viral hepatitis was seropositive for anti-HCV. It is concluded that HCV is a major cause of chronic hepatitis in patients with
thalassaemia
major and is associated with raised AST activity and serum ferritin concentration compared with patients seronegative for anti-HCV.

We studied 29 patients with
thalassaemia
major who had received intensive chelation for between 6.2 and 8.8 years. All patients had normal oral glucose tolerance tests before subcutaneous chelation therapy was introduced and 22 of 29 patients had normal liver function tests. At the end of the period of study 12 patients still had normal oral glucose tolerance (7 with normal liver function tests and 5 with
chronic active hepatitis
). On the other hand, 11 patients had developed impaired glucose tolerance tests (3 patients had normal liver function tests, 5 with
chronic active hepatitis
and 3 with cirrhosis), and 6 patients had developed frank diabetes mellitus (one with
chronic active hepatitis
and 5 with cirrhosis). Patients with
chronic active hepatitis
showed 91% positivity for one or more hepatitis B markers whilst all patients with cirrhosis were positive. Ferritin levels before subcutaneous chelation in patients with normal oral glucose tolerance tests were lower than in those patients with abnormal oral glucose tolerance or diabetes (P less than 0.05) but none had normal serum ferritin levels. In addition, a positive correlation was found between glucose area under the curve after chelation therapy and serum ferritin levels (r = 0.47, P less than 0.01). It is apparent that long term chelation therapy does not prevent the development of abnormal oral glucose tolerance in chronically transfused patients. More intensive chelation therapy is needed to prevent tissue damage. Chronic liver disease may have an important role to play in the deterioration of glucose tolerance.

Serum ferritin, an index of iron stores, was studied in 60 patients with porphyria cutanea tarda (PCT), in 21 patients who had other liver diseases without siderosis (cirrhosis [LC] and
chronic active hepatitis
[
CAH
]), and in 32 patients with associated liver siderosis (alcoholic LC, LC and
CAH
in minor
thalassemia
). Ferritin levels were higher in patients with porphyria than in healthy controls and patients without liver siderosis (P less than 0.001), whereas no statistical difference was observed between patients with porphyria and those with liver siderosis. Because iron removal is considered the treatment of choice for PCT, some patients with PCT underwent phlebotomy and others received chelating therapy with subcutaneous infusion of deferoxamine. Follow-up of the patients showed a correlation between serum ferritin level and urinary porphyrin excretion; when the clinical and biochemical syndrome became normal, serum iron and ferritin had fallen to normal values (t test pair data analysis before and after: P less than 0.001 in each group). No appreciable difference was found between controls and patients with PCT whose conditions had been normalized, irrespective of the chronic liver damage always present in PCT. Our results suggest that serum ferritin increase in PCT is related more to liver iron overload than to liver damage, and ferritin follow-up is recommended to indicate the exhaustion of hepatic iron stores during iron depletion therapy, as well as to detect an early replenishment after remission.

Some parameters of iron metabolism in 26 patients with porphyria cutanea tarda (PCT) which is often associated with mild iron overload and hepatic siderosis, are studied. Serum iron, percent transferrin saturation and ferritin were pathologically increased. Statistical comparisons were performed between PCT patients and healthy controls, liver disease patients (cirrhosis,
chronic active hepatitis
) and patients with associated liver siderosis (alcoholic cirrhosis, cirrhosis and
chronic active hepatitis
in
thalassemia
). Ferritin levels are higher in patients with porphyria than in healthy controls (p less than 0,001) and in patients without liver siderosis (p less than 0,001). No statistical difference is observed between patients with porphyria and patients with siderosis. A significant decrease in ferritin levels is registered after venesection therapy. The conclusion is drawn that serum ferritin increase in PCT is related to hepatic iron store amounts rather than hepatic necrosis. It is assumed that ferritin follow-up during phlebotomy therapy and also during remission is useful to indicate the exhaustion or an early replenishment of hepatic iron stores.

A non-specific iron fraction, not bound to transferrin, has been looked for in the sera of 42 never-transfused patients with beta-
thalassaemia
trait, 17 of whom had
chronic active hepatitis
, negative for HBV infection or alcohol abuse. Non-specific iron was found only in the sera of those patients with beta-
thalassaemia
trait plus
chronic active hepatitis
who had complete transferrin saturation, high serum ferritin levels and urinary iron excretion and a high degree of hepatic siderosis. In view of the known toxicity of non-transferrin iron, we suggest that this non-transferrin iron fraction may be responsible for the liver damage in these patients. Furthermore, the positive correlation between the presence and the amount of non-transferrin iron and the levels of serum ferritin suggests that this fraction is a sensitive indicator of iron-induced toxicity when severe iron overload slowly develops in patients with beta-
thalassaemia
trait even in the absence of any iron administration.

The systematic screening of 253 children with transfusion-dependent homozygous beta-
thalassaemia
revealed a high incidence of hepatitis B virus markers. The highest frequencies of hepatitis B surface antigen (HBsAg) and antibody to hepatitis B core antigen (anti-HBc) were found in the group of patients with the smallest number of transfusions, while the highest frequency of antibody to hepatitis B surface antigen (anti-HBs) was detected in the patients who had had the largest number of transfusions. Follow-up of these patients showed (a) a high incidence of acute hepatitis B, which was mainly subclinical; (b) normal hepatitis B surface antigen clearance and normal antibody to hepatitis B surface development; and (c) a high frequency of increased transaminase values for over six months. In all the subjects with persistently high transaminase, histological examination revealed chronic persistent hepatitis or
chronic active hepatitis
. Apart from two cases of
chronic active hepatitis
with no B virus markers, and two cases of chronic persistent hepatitis with HBsAg and anti-HBc in the serum, all these subjects were anti-HBs positive but HGsAg and anti-HBc negative.

We studied 95 patients and their relatives with the classical salt wasting (SW) and simple virilizing (SV) form of
CAH
. SSCP/heteroduplex analysis allowed fast and efficient screening for the most common 21-hydroxylase mutations (e.g. deletions, splice site mutation in intron 2 (bp 656), Ile172Asn mutation in exon 4) and determination of the relative intensities of CYP21A and CYP21B genes. The splice site mutation in intron 2 was found as the most frequent cause of 21-hydroxylase deficiency (35% of our patients). There is a strong genetic association between the mutation in intron 2 and the SW form of
CAH
. On the other hand, about 20% of our patients with the intron 2 mutation have the SV phenotype. Interestingly, homozygous splice site mutations in intron 2 were also detected in some parents or other relatives with no phenotypic changes typical for
CAH
(clinical evaluation, steroid hormone levels). In those patients with SV-
CAH
and especially in the relatives with the homozygous intron 2 mutation and an unaffected phenotype, the splice site mutation could be "leaky". mRNA-splicing in the adrenal cortex should result in a high degree of normal mRNA species. This is in contrast to in vitro expression studies of CYP21B genes containing the intron 2 mutation, performed by other groups. However, the results of in vitro expression studies are not always reflecting the in vivo conditions in the adrenal cortex. This situation is in good agreement with the variable degree of normal spliced mRNA and different phenotypic severity in intron mutations found in
thalassemia
.

The purpose of this study was to determine whether interferon-alfa (IFN-alpha) therapy benefits patients with transfusion-dependent
thalassemia
and
chronic active hepatitis
C, and whether their iron burden modifies the response to this therapy. We conducted a controlled trial of recombinant IFN-alpha (3 million units per square meter of body surface area, three times a week for 15 months) in 65 patients with
thalassaemia
major and
chronic active hepatitis
C; 14 of them were untreated control subjects. In 21 of the 51 treated patients, alanine aminotransferase values returned to normal within 6 months, and hepatitis C virus ribonucleic acid was no longer detected in serum; no changes were detected among control subjects. The response to IFN-alpha therapy was inversely related (p < 0.002) to the liver iron burden as assessed by atomic absorption, the histologic semiquantitative method, or both methods. During 3 years of follow-up, two responder patients had relapses. We conclude that IFN-alpha represents a useful therapeutic option for children with transfusion-dependent
thalassemia
and
chronic active hepatitis
C with a mild to moderate iron burden.

Hepatitis C virus (HCV) is responsible for the majority of cases of post transfusion non-A non-B (NANB) hepatitis in
thalassaemia
major (TM). Fifteen multi-transfused TM patients with serological, biochemical, histological and molecular biological evidence of HCV infection have been treated for six months with recombinant alpha interferon (IFN). Eleven (73%) responded, 8 (53%) had complete response (CR), 3 (20%) partial response (PR) and 4 (27%) did not respond (NR) to IFN. Natural killer (NK) cell activity 24 hours after the first dose of IFN was significantly increased in responders as compared to non-responders. Liver histology showed an overall reduction of portal inflammation and periportal necrosis in the responding patients. HCV RNA disappeared from serum in 8 (15) responders and partial responders. Non responders remained positive. HCV RNA was tested and found to be positive in liver tissue material in 7 patients, five of those were re-tested after IFN treatment. Two became negative (both CR) 3 remained positive despite biochemical response to IFN. The degree of induction of peripheral blood mononuclear cell 2'5' oligoadenylate synthetase messenger RNA (2-5 OAS mRNA), an enzyme induced by IFN, after the first dose of IFN did not correlate with response neither was any significant interaction with cytokines observed; tumour necrosis factor (TNF), interleukin-1. (IL-1) and CD4:CD8 ratios did not change. We conclude that IFN should be given to all TM patients with
chronic active hepatitis
due to HCV.
